How AI Is Rewriting Architectural Visualization
Architectural visualization is entering one of the most important transitions in its history. For many years, rendering was mostly about technical precision: creating realistic materials, controlling light, setting cameras, and producing beautiful still images. But today, artificial intelligence is changing the way artists think, work, and present architectural ideas.
AI is not simply making rendering faster. It is expanding what rendering can become.
In the past, a typical workflow started with a 3D model, followed by materials, lighting, rendering, and post-production. This process still matters, but it is no longer the whole story. With AI tools, artists can now explore concepts faster, create mood variations, enhance images, generate atmosphere, improve details, and even transform still renders into cinematic videos.
This shift is moving architectural visualization from static image-making toward visual storytelling.

From Realism to Experience
The goal of rendering used to be simple: make the image look real. Realism is still important, but clients and audiences now expect more. They want emotion, atmosphere, movement, and a stronger sense of story.
A great render today is not only technically accurate. It should communicate how a space feels.
This is where AI becomes powerful. It can help artists test different moods, lighting conditions, materials, and visual directions in a much shorter time. A simple clay render or base image can become the starting point for multiple creative possibilities.
Instead of spending days on early visual experiments, artists can now explore ideas in minutes and make better creative decisions earlier in the process.
What AI Can Change
AI is already improving several parts of the rendering workflow.
It can help with concept development, reference creation, image enhancement, upscaling, background generation, material exploration, and visual variations. It can also support animation by turning still images into short cinematic clips.
For architectural visualization, this is a major change. A render is no longer just a final output. It can become part of a larger presentation system that includes images, motion, storytelling, and social media-ready content.
This creates new opportunities for artists who understand both traditional 3D skills and modern AI workflows.

What AI Cannot Replace
Even with all these possibilities, AI cannot replace the most important part of the creative process: human judgment.
AI can generate images, but it does not truly understand architecture. It does not know why a space should feel calm, dramatic, luxurious, warm, or minimal. It cannot fully replace composition, lighting sensitivity, design logic, storytelling, or communication with clients.
A strong artist knows how to guide the image.
They understand where the camera should be placed, how light should shape the mood, which details matter, and how to create a visual message that feels intentional. These decisions are still deeply human.
In the AI era, artists will not disappear. But their role will change.

The Challenges Ahead
The rise of AI also brings challenges. The market may become more crowded because more people can create attractive images quickly. This means originality, taste, and strong artistic direction will become even more important.
There are also concerns about copyright, image accuracy, overused styles, and generic-looking results. AI can create impressive visuals, but it can also create mistakes, unrealistic details, or images without personality.
That is why human control is essential.
AI should not replace the artist’s eye. It should support it.
